" A BEAUTIFULLY PRESENTED TERRACED HOUSE CLOSE TO THE CENTRE OF THE VILLAGE OVERLOOKING A SMALL GREEN AND WITH SOUTH FACING REAR GARDEN.

Entrance hall, cloakroom, sitting room, dining room, kitchen, utility room, 3 bedrooms, bathroom/W.C., electric heating, double glazing, gardens.

This attractive, older style terraced house forms part of a small group of houses overlooking a permanent green and being very close to the heart of the village. East Hoathly is a popular village with good local amenities including shops, public houses, primary school and church. The nearby A22 provides fast vehicular access to the larger towns of Uckfield, Hailsham and the south coast at Eastbourne. The nearest mainline railway stations are at Uckfield and Lewes.

The house has been extensively improved over the years by the present owners with the addition of a ground floor cloakroom and utility room, UPVC framed double glazing and the creation of an easily maintained and quite delightful, south facing rear garden.
